the first step in formulating a cross-region backup and disaster recovery strategy is to clarify business priorities and recovery goals: set strict rto and rpo for critical systems, and use a looser window for non-critical systems. architecturally, it is recommended to use at least two independent availability zones or data centers as primary/backup nodes. the primary site is located in malaysia, and the backup site can be selected in a nearby area to take into account latency and regulations. the storage layer combines block storage snapshots, incremental replication and object storage cold backup; the database adopts master-slave or multi-master replication (such as mysql replication, postgresql streaming replication), and uses asynchronous replication for logs and transactions to reduce cross-region write latency. for applications using vps or cloud hosts , it is recommended to implement replication at the instance layer and storage layer at the same time to ensure snapshot and metadata consistency.implement technology and network switching
at the implementation level, available technologies include storage-based block-level replication, file/object-based incremental synchronization, and logical or physical replication of the database. for static content and full-site acceleration, deploying a global cdn can reduce user-perceived interruptions during switching; combined with low-ttl intelligent dns and health detection, traffic can be quickly switched to the backup site when the primary site is unavailable, and combined with floating ip or bgp routing, a shorter switching time window can be achieved. to ensure smooth domain name switching, domain name providers and dns services need to support multi-region health checks and api-based operations. in terms of network, attention should be paid to cross-region link bandwidth, delay and packet loss rate. if necessary, use dedicated lines or sd-wan to optimize primary and backup links. we recommend dexun telecom’s technical support on local backbone interconnection and dedicated line access to ensure link stability.
security, compliance and anti-ddos design
cross-region disaster recovery is not only about data availability, but also takes into account security and compliance. encryption (transport layer and data-at-rest encryption) must be enabled for data transfer and snapshot storage, and desensitization or classification policies must be implemented for sensitive data. in terms of network security, vpc segmentation, bastion machines, fine-grained security groups and waf protection are used, together with log auditing and intrusion detection. in the face of large traffic attacks, cdn should be combined with cloud ddos defense , and traffic cleaning, rate limiting, and abnormal traffic blackhole strategies should be used to reduce the pressure on the main site. for data sovereignty requirements involving local regulations, design a data residency policy and clarify compliance boundaries at the backup destination.drills, operations and cost optimization
